摘 要: 结合智能电网背景下需求侧管理向需求响应发展的趋势,在分析广州地区电力需求侧管理存在问题的基础上,针对性地提出了一种基于需求响应建设要求的分布式信息交互服务平台实现策略和具体建设方案,划分了终端层、电力用户层、区局层、市局层的信息系统结构层次,对区局分站信息中心功能结构进行系统设计,使其满足市局、区局2级的电力需求侧信息监控的要求,实现供电和用电之间的数据交互和共享,并据此建设了广州地区电力需求响应信息交互平台。实践表明,该平台具有实现快速的信息交互及需求响应能力。 Combined with tile developnu:nt trend of demand side management to demand response under the small grid.
